$18,000 bucks, forget it. Too expensive for me. The burglers would either drop kick it up off the wall or steal it themselves.
When I think about it, I could probably build one for a lot less. You can use a MCU, a room motion detector, a modem, and have it dial up your cell phone messaging service and email you a text message to your cell phone. Cost would be whatever you have in your junk box already or how much full cost you'd want to spend. Defintely not more than a few hundred. I think they've got articles on this using the Parallax Basic Stamps too.
